Pneumocystis carinii pneumonia: epidemiology in Japan, and cyst concentration method.

Y Yoshida, T Ikai.   

Abstract

Pneumocystis carinii pneumonia has been markedly increasing recently in Japan. Most cases are seen after receiving anti-cancer and immunosuppressive therapy against their underlying diseases. No cases have been found in undernourished or premature infants. The authors proposed a new method which can concentrate the cysts efficiently from the human and animal lungs, and express the density of infection quantitatively at the same time. This method will especially be valuable to demonstrate the organism in light infection such as latent infection, after treatment, and so on.
